MYD Construction Update

Construction for Phase II of MYD's modern renovation in Mission Viejo kicks off this week...

While the majority of the work focuses on the reconfigured and updated kitchen, the scope of the project also includes a new guest bath, redesigned stair and open, light-filled living and dining spaces.

Project Preview: Laguna Niguel Modern

Last month, an 'On the Boards' post highlighted a few current projects in various stages, from schematic design to construction. This week, we're taking a closer look at a nearby residential project, now in design development.

A renovation to a mid-century residence in Laguna Niguel, the existing home was designed by architect George Arthur Bissell and built in the mid-60's; our redesign will update the home while preserving the modernist aesthetic.

Eames House: MYD's photo gallery

A couple weeks ago, we shared a sneak peek of a recent trip to the Eames House, also known as Case Study House #8. We stopped to look at the Pacific Standard Time exhibit, Indoor Ecologies: The Evolution of the Eames House Living Room and, of course, to visit one of the most well-known homes in the discussion of mid-century modernism.

'EAMES WORDS' at A+D

We recently visited the A+D Architecture and Design Museum in Los Angeles to view the exhibit EAMES WORDS, part of the Pacific Standard Time initiative celebrating Southern California art. Only one of the several galleries highlighting the work of Charles and Ray Eames, this show examines the relationships between well-known words and quotations of the husband and wife team and the everyday objects that inspired and informed their practice, philosophy and approach to design.
